FLiRT Variant Alert – Understanding Symptoms and Vital Precautions Amid Rising Concerns.
It seems like the COVID-19 landscape is evolving once again, with a new group of variants within the Omicron JN.1 lineage making headlines. Dubbed FLiRT, these variants, including KP.2 and KP 1.1, are causing a stir as they spread rapidly across the United States.
What sets these variants apart are their new mutations, which experts warn make them even more contagious than previous iterations of the Omicron strain. However, amidst the concern, there’s some reassurance that the symptoms associated with FLiRT variants largely mirror those of other Omicron infections.
KP.2, in particular, has surged ahead, surpassing the JN.1 variant in the US. Thankfully, despite their heightened transmissibility, reports suggest that hospitalizations due to FLiRT variants remain relatively low. Meanwhile, KP.1.1, another member of the FLiRT group, has also been detected in the US, albeit seemingly less widespread than its KP.2 counterpart.
The moniker “FLiRT” derives from the technical names of the variants’ mutations, offering a catchy shorthand for discussing these emerging strains. Dr. Pavithra Venkatagopalan, a microbiologist and coronavirus expert, underscores that while FLiRT variants are noteworthy, their symptoms align closely with those of previously known COVID-19 variants.
What are the Significant Symptoms of FLiRT Variants?
Typical symptoms associated with FLiRT variants include sore throat, cough, congestion or runny nose, fatigue, headache, muscle or body aches, fever or chills, and less commonly, loss of taste or smell—a symptom less prevalent with Omicron compared to earlier variants.
Dr. Modi sheds light on the concerning aspects of FLiRT variants, noting their increased transmissibility and potential to evade immunity from prior infection and vaccines. However, the full extent of these traits is still under investigation.
Looking ahead, Dr. Wali emphasizes the importance of updating vaccines to address emerging variants like KP 1.1, aligning with WHO guidelines. This proactive approach underscores the ongoing efforts to stay one step ahead of the virus and protect public health.
